Materials controller based at Newbridge / Kildare — Thermo Fisher Scientific. This role includes working at the customer site with responsibilities in material handling, shipping/receiving, glassware washing, and related administrative duties.


Responsibilities

* Make on-site program replenishments and disbursements. Perform stockroom duties including receiving, put-away, stock rotation, cycle counts, and other functions according to customer requirements.
* Order Management: order entry, order expediting, and customer service support.
* Chemical Management: receive, register, and track chemical containers.
* Glass Wash Operations: pick up glassware from labs, replace with clean glassware, perform glass wash sterilization processes, and inspect glassware.
* Follow well-defined Best Practices, SOPs, and work instructions.
* Prepare for customer meetings.
* Embrace Practical Process Improvement (PPI) methodologies to improve customer and internal processes.
* Support new customer additions and storerooms.
* Represent Thermo Fisher Scientific professionally and positively at customer locations.


Schedule & Environment

Standard (Mon-Fri), Day Shift. Workplace environments include Office and Warehouse; PPE is required and some exposure to hazardous/toxic materials. Adherence to GMP Safety Standards. Based on client site (Newbridge / Kildare).
